This weekend, cultural life was in full swing in Sheptytskyi, with our fellow citizens from Donetsk region taking part.

Twenty-five displaced persons who are active users of the services provided by the Pokrovsk community's humanitarian hub “Yednannia” had the opportunity to attend the play “Bagini” at the Sheptytskyi People's House free of charge.

This evening was a bright event that took place as part of the national project “Side by Side: United Communities,” whose goal is not only to provide material support, but also to create a space for cultural leisure, emotional relaxation, and socialization for those who were forced to leave their homes.

The performance by the Lesya Ukrainka National Music and Drama Theater, based on a play by Natalia Uvarova, was a real “laughter therapy,” which is so necessary in difficult times.

Those present in the hall also came together again to help our defenders—during the performance, funds were collected for the needs of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. 

Evenings of cultural leisure and emotional relaxation help us endure difficult times far from our native Donetsk region, bring joy from time spent together, and strengthen our unity. This is our common front of emotional resilience.
